Step 1
First, make the crust by combining all ingredients in a bowl and then kneading for a couple minutes until a soft dough if formed. If it feels too sticky, add some extra flour, a tablespoon at a time. Too dry? Add some extra buttermilk or a little water, a teaspoon at a time.
Step 2
Allow the dough to rest for 45 minutes.
Step 3
In the meantime, prepare all the ingredients for the topping and mix together in a bowl.
Step 4
Pre-heat the oven to 220C / 430F once the dough is almost finished resting.
Step 5
Once the dough is ready, stretch it or roll it out as thin as you can onto a pizza stone or baking tray. Top with slices of the mozzarella.
Step 6
Bake for 10 to 12 minutes, until the crust is cooked through and golden and the mozzarella is melted and starting to crisp.
Step 7
Scatter the topping over the pizza.
Step 8
Decisions, decisions. You can either eat the pizza now, with the topping still a little cold and fresh, or you can put it back in the oven for 1 or 2 minutes so the topping warms up and softens a little. It's great both ways!
